The majority of craters on Pandora are shallow as a result of being filled with debris.
[10] The orbit of Pandora appears to be chaotic as a consequence of a series of four 118:121 mean-motion resonances with Prometheus.
[11] The most appreciable changes in their orbits occur approximately every 6.2 years,[2] when the periapsis of Pandora lines up with the apoapsis of Prometheus and the moons approach to within about 1,400 kilometres (870 mi).
[2] From its very low density and relatively high albedo, it seems likely that Pandora is a very porous icy body.
